Here’s a very interesting blend that you don’t see every day - WiseGuy has never seen one! Lange Twins is a new winery started by twin brothers of a five generation wine growing family in the Lodi area. This wine is 66% Petit Verdot and 34% Petite Sirah. It’s very Rhone-ish in style, with a nice blackfruit nose with an orange zest note. The palate is deep and dark, with mocha, blackberry, blueberry pie, bitters, and cedar tones. This is a huge, brooding wine that improves with air, adding earthy notes as well. A great value!
13.9% alcohol. 200 cases produced. SRP 20.00.
